Use isl::manage_copy to simplify calls to isl::manage(isl_.._copy())
authorTobias Grosser <tobias@grosser.es>
Tue, 20 Feb 2018 07:26:58 +0000 (07:26 +0000)
committerTobias Grosser <tobias@grosser.es>
Tue, 20 Feb 2018 07:26:58 +0000 (07:26 +0000)
commit718d04c6534cc83f8d48b9ce94dcb3f46e02a7e7
tree429d7e53ecf79e249703e665448fafbb236860cb
parentfa8079d0dc1b9fbca201b92f30d3c97386c75114
Use isl::manage_copy to simplify calls to isl::manage(isl_.._copy())

As part of this cleanup a couple of unnecessary isl::manage(obj.copy()) pattern
are eliminated as well.

We checked for all potential cleanups by scanning for:

  "grep -R isl::manage\( lib/ | grep copy"

llvm-svn: 325558
polly/lib/Analysis/ScopInfo.cpp
polly/lib/CodeGen/BlockGenerators.cpp
polly/lib/CodeGen/IslAst.cpp
polly/lib/CodeGen/IslNodeBuilder.cpp
polly/lib/CodeGen/PPCGCodeGeneration.cpp
polly/lib/Support/ISLTools.cpp
polly/lib/Support/SCEVAffinator.cpp
polly/lib/Transform/DeLICM.cpp
polly/lib/Transform/ScheduleOptimizer.cpp